Obituary: Doris Stettler, Co-Founder of Deaf Hearing Communication Centre

Doris W. Stettler, 95, a long time resident of Springfield, and most-recently a resident of Media, died peacefully at her home on Nov. 8, 2011.

Doris was born on Dec. 1, 1915 and graduated from West Philadelphia High School in 1933. She worked at PSFS in the Real Estate Department where she met her loving husband, Arthur W. Stettler.

Doris will be remembered as a woman who gave selflessly to her family, friends, church and community. In 1972 she co-founded the Deaf Hearing Communication Centre, Inc. (DHCC), which will celebrate its 40th anniversary in 2012. In 1977, she was the recipient of the Benjamin Rush Award being recognized by the Delaware County Medical Society. She has been an active member of Covenant United Methodist Church in Springfield for 54 years, where she started the Reassurance Program that reaches out to homebound individuals. She served as President of Springfield Woman’s Club, was a Trustee at Covenant Church, is a Lioness, and was President of the Home and School Association at .

Doris was named Exemplary Volunteer of the Year and recognized on Springfield’s Volunteer Memorial Wall in 1997. She also received the Girl Scout Woman-of-the-Year award in 1987 and the Springfield Historical Society Person-of-the-Year award in 1984. She was honored by the Springfield in 1978.

Doris was an avid Phillies fan and loved deep-sea fishing. She also enjoyed dancing, ice-skating, bowling, cooking and reading. She vacationed annually with family in Ocean City, NJ and enjoyed trips to Australia, Hawaii, Mexico, New Zealand, Fiji, Alaska and the Panama Canal. Doris was also a devoted Kentucky Derby fan, especially being a Kentucky Colonel.
